Water Filtration Installation in Tampa, FL
Water filtration installation services involve setting up systems that improve the quality of tap water throughout a home. These projects typically include installing whole-house filtration units, under-sink filters, or point-of-use systems designed to remove impurities, sediments, chlorine, and other contaminants. Homeowners often seek these services to ensure their drinking water is clean and safe, to improve the taste and odor of their water, or to address specific concerns such as hard water or mineral buildup. Before requesting installation, property owners usually want to understand the types of filtration systems available, how they work, and which options best suit their household needs.
Understanding the scope of water filtration installation projects is essential for homeowners considering this service. It’s important to assess the current water quality, determine the desired level of filtration, and identify any specific contaminants that need removal. Property owners should also consider the space available for equipment, maintenance requirements, and compatibility with existing plumbing.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the selected system effectively meets household needs and provides long-term benefits for water quality.

Common Water Filtration Installation Jobs
Whole House Water Filtration - improves water quality for every tap in the home.
Under-Sink Filtration Systems - provides clean drinking water directly at the kitchen sink.
Point-of-Entry Filtration - reduces contaminants before water enters the home's plumbing system.
Reverse Osmosis Systems - removes impurities for safer, better-tasting water.
Salt-Free Water Conditioners - help prevent scale buildup without adding salt.
Custom Water Filtration Installations - tailored to meet specific water quality needs of the property.
